Also, don't know if it's up your ally, but if you liked Strawberry Panic, and you haven't already, you could also check out Simoun and Maria-sama ga Miteru. Simoun was released about the same time as Strawberry Panic, but instead of a private school, has a War/Sci-fi setting. I never really got into it, but it actually received very good reviews. Maria-sama is also pretty popular (3 12-episode seasons, 1 OVA series). Similar setting to Strawberry Panic, but much heavier on the subtext. It's also a verrrrry relaxed show in terms of pace, but you can make your own judgments based on the first two episodes alone.

Utena was interesting because of how it used limited budget and recycled footage. Clip shows and recap episodes, which normally one would skip, contained some of the biggest plot point and twists. In the Second Round/End of the World arc (the third season), every episode had the same footage with Touga calling forth the car, and every Akio Car sequence was the same. Eventually they start making fun of this in-universe. Every fight that season, save the final one, was almost exactly the same. Again, plot importance- everything was going exactly how Akio planned it, and the duels themselves no longer mattered.
